Hamza Meddeb
Research Fellow, Malcolm H. Kerr Carnegie Middle East Center
Hamza Meddeb is a research fellow at the Malcolm H. Kerr Carnegie Middle East Center in Beirut, where he co-leads the Political Economy Program. His research focuses on the political economy of Tunisia and North Africa, comparative politics, and the development-security nexus. He is the co-author of The State of Injustice in the Maghreb: Morocco and Tunisia. Dr. Meddeb holds a PhD in political science from Sciences Po Paris, as well as Master’s degrees in comparative politics and in international economics from the University of Paris.
